Grill size and cooking surface

The dimension of your cooking area dictates your grilling capabilities, from weeknight dinners to weekend gatherings.

Consider how many people you typically cook for. A compact design might suffice for solo cooks or small apartments, offering portability and easy storage.

A common benchmark for moderate family use is around 300-400 square inches of cooking space, allowing for a few steaks, burgers, or a whole chicken. For larger crowds, aim for over 500 square inches. When evaluating options, measure the actual grilling grate dimensions to accurately gauge its capacity.

Material and durability

A grill’s construction materials and enduring quality are paramount for achieving consistent grilling experiences and ensuring your investment stands the test of time.

The quality of the cooking grates, for instance, directly affects food presentation and ease of cleaning. Porcelain-enameled grates offer a non-stick surface and resist rust better than standard chrome, though chrome is often more budget-friendly.

Equally important is the integrity of the lid and kettle. A well-built kettle, typically made from thick gauge steel with a durable finish, retains heat effectively for even cooking. Look for sturdy hinges and secure leg attachments that promise stability, especially on uneven outdoor terrain.

These elements are designed for continuous exposure to the elements, meaning components should be robust enough to withstand sun, rain, and temperature fluctuations. A sturdy build, often indicated by a heavier feel and tight-fitting seams, translates to a grill that can handle frequent use and maintain its performance season after season, making it a reliable partner for countless outdoor meals.

Temperature control features

Effective heat management is paramount for transforming simple ingredients into culinary masterpieces, even on a budget.

The ability to precisely regulate the cooking temperature is what separates a perfectly seared steak from a charred outcome. Without it, achieving consistent results becomes a frustrating guessing game.

Look for grills with adjustable vents, typically located on the lid and the base. These openings dictate airflow, the very lifeblood of your charcoal fire; opening them wider feeds oxygen to the coals, increasing heat, while closing them down stifles the flame, lowering temperature.

Mastering these elements allows you to master direct searing at high temperatures, indirect low-and-slow smoking, or gentle warming, ensuring your food cooks evenly and deliciously every time.

Frequently Asked Questions

What Is The Typical Size Of A Charcoal Grill Under $100?

Most charcoal grills in this price range offer a cooking surface between 200-300 square inches, suitable for small to medium gatherings.

Are Charcoal Grills Under $100 Durable?

Durability varies, but many models feature porcelain-enameled steel for a good balance of longevity and affordability.

How Important Are Temperature Control Features On A Budget Grill?

Adjustable vents are crucial for managing airflow and controlling cooking temperature, essential for delicious results.

Is Cleaning Difficult On Inexpensive Charcoal Grills?

Many budget grills include a removable ash catcher, which significantly simplifies the cleaning process after use.

What Should I Look For In Terms Of Safety For A Charcoal Grill Under $100?

Ensure the grill has sturdy legs or a stable base, and handles that stay cool to the touch during operation.
